Liability insurance
If you regularly visit clients it is important to ensure you have protection in place should an accident occur as a result of something you’ve done. Public liability insurance would help cover any claims made against you by a client or member of the public for compensation. Employers’ liability insurance is required by law if you employ staff, and will protect you if an employee makes a claim for personal injury.
